Finance Manager, Supply Chain

As a Financial Services Manager I, Supply Chain with The Coca-Cola Company, you’ll help us transform our business. In this role, you’ll be responsible for leading the management, implementation, and execution of the Engineering Capital and OPEX budget. You’ll work closely with Coca-Cola engineers, Plant leaders, and Capital Finance team, to develop project capital submission plans, budgets, and cash flow tracking that meet our transformation goals. The qualified candidate will be solutions-oriented and will have a track record of successfully managing cash flow, along with the ability to work in teams and manage conflicting interests.

What You’ll Do for Us

  • Leads finance tracking aspects in the evaluation, troubleshooting and implementation of new capital projects, assets under construction, and project schedules.

  • Collaboratives with technical teams in the execution of cash flow, and innovative solutions to track project schedules.

  • Execute award of critical PO's required for project execution, track expenditures, develop cost analysis, and provide issue resolution when needed.

  • Monthly project planning/coordination – Management of Engineering PMO

  • Management of OEM’s & contractors within SAP – approvals and deactivations

  • Analyze Capital spending across BU’s, manufacturing facilities, and provide a detailed overview of investments.

  • Manage weekly cash flow tracking communications with engineers, facilities, and NAOU ELT.

  • Manage Capital Project annual schedule and downtime calendar requirements for plants.

  • Support Annual LRP Capital development, collect information for project submissions, align on next year’s capital needs with ELT, and submittal of information to KO Capital team.
